
Malakia Elindi, one of the accused in the alleged NAMCOR fraud case, has been admitted to a private hospital in Windhoek, his lawyer Sisa Namandje informed the court on Friday.
Namandje disclosed this during the ongoing bail hearing, which entered its final stage today. State advocate Basson Lilungwe is expected to deliver oral arguments before Magistrate Linus Samunzala, marking the last day for arguments in the matter.
Elindi is among several individuals implicated in the high-profile case involving alleged financial irregularities at the National Petroleum Corporation of Namibia (NAMCOR).
The court will determine whether to grant bail after hearing submissions from both the defence and the State.
